I have a 30" DL and use a D-loopand can shoot my buddy's 29" bow.

The best thing to do is try it out and make sure your anchor point is in the right place. Depending on the bow you should be able to either adjust right on the bow or buy modules to increase the DL.

Making sure the string anchors on your face properly is the most important thing. The arrow nock should be udner your eye.
